>> >> Hi everyone. There have no bids for an D8  additional Championship  following
>> >> our Rain out of the Dusters/Becks field championship.
>> >> 
>> >> Thanks to Sean Mersh for the score keeping, here is the outcome for the 2021
>> >> season .
>> >> 
>> >> Sportsman:
>> >> Scott Nagler with 24 points, but he is not an NSRCA member (all four pilots in
>> >> the class are not members 😟)
>> >> 
>> >> Intermediate:
>> >> Ray Wasson with 31 points
>> >> 
>> >> Advanced:
>> >> Jim Hiller with 30 points
>> >> 
>> >> Masters:
>> >> Bob Crump with 35 points
>> >> 
>> >> FAI Silver:
>> >> Sean Mersh with 45 points
>> >> 
>> >> FAI:
>> >> Alexander Safarik with 11 points
>> >> 
>> >> 
>> >> The sportsman pilots are not eligible for the award for district champion as
>> >> they are not  NSRCA members.
>> >> 
>> >> Congratulations to everyone  for their commitment to pattern.
